mysql空值 mysql表示空字符串

导读:MySQL是一种常用的关系型数据库管理系统,它支持存储和管理各种数据类型,包括字符串 。在MySQL中,空字符串是一个非常重要的概念,因为它可以表示许多不同的情况 。本文将介绍如何在MySQL中表示空字符串,并探讨其在实际应用中的作用 。
1. 空字符串的定义
在MySQL中,空字符串是指没有任何字符的字符串 。它与NULL值不同 , NULL值表示缺少值或未知值,而空字符串表示有一个值,但该值为空 。
2. 如何表示空字符串
在MySQL中,可以使用单引号或双引号来表示空字符串 。例如,''或""都可以表示一个空字符串 。此外,还可以使用函数来表示空字符串,例如:
SELECT IFNULL(column_name,'') FROM table_name;
这个语句将返回column_name列的值,如果该值为NULL,则返回一个空字符串 。
3. 空字符串的作用
空字符串在MySQL中有许多实际应用 。例如,在创建表时 , 可以将某些列设置为允许为空字符串 。这意味着在插入数据时,可以将该列留空,而不必提供任何值 。另外,空字符串还可以用于搜索和过滤数据,例如:
SELECT * FROM table_name WHERE column_name='';
这个语句将返回所有column_name列值为空字符串的行 。
【mysql空值 mysql表示空字符串】总结:空字符串是MySQL中一个重要的概念,它可以表示许多不同的情况 。在MySQL中,可以使用单引号或双引号来表示空字符串,也可以使用函数来表示 。空字符串在实际应用中有许多作用,例如用于创建表时设置允许为空字符串的列,以及用于搜索和过滤数据 。

    推荐阅读